  <longdescription>
     CoreDNS is a DNS server/forwarder, written in Go, that chains plugins.
     It is fast and flexible. The key word here is flexible:
     with CoreDNS you are able to do what you want with your DNS data by utilizing plugins.
     CoreDNS can listen for DNS requests coming in over UDP/TCP (go'old DNS), TLS (RFC 7858),
     also called DoT, DNS over HTTP/2 - DoH - (RFC 8484) and gRPC (not a standard).
  </longdescription>
